Third Quarter 2025 Business Highlights and Upcoming Milestones:

 

Clinical Highlights

 

Tinlarebant is an oral, potent, once-daily, retinol binding protein 4 (RBP4) antagonist that decreases RBP4 levels in the blood and reduces vitamin A (retinol) delivery to the eye without disrupting systemic retinol delivery to other tissues. Vitamin A is critical for normal vision but can accumulate as toxic byproducts in individuals affected with STGD1 and GA, the advanced form of dry age-related macular degeneration (AMD), leading to retinal cell death and loss of vision.

 

· Stargardt disease (STGD1): Accumulation of cytotoxic vitamin A byproducts (bisretinoids) compounds has been implicated in the onset and progression of STGD1, for which there is no approved treatment. Tinlarebant has been granted Breakthrough Therapy, Fast Track and Rare Pediatric Disease Designations in the U.S.; Orphan Drug Designation in the U.S., Europe, and Japan; and Sakigake (Pioneer Drug) Designation in Japan for the treatment of STGD1.

 

o DRAGON Trial: Completed, 24-month, 104 subjects, randomized (2:1, active: placebo), double-masked, placebo-controlled, global, multi-center, pivotal Phase 3 trial in adolescent STGD1 patients

 

· Primary efficacy endpoint is the growth rate of atrophic lesions; safety and tolerability will also be assessed.

 

· Independent Data Safety Monitoring Board (DSMB) recommended trial continuation without modifications at interim analysis, and supported data submission for regulatory review for drug approval.

 

· Granted Breakthrough Therapy Designation by the US FDA supported by interim analysis results

 

· Center for Drug Evaluation of China’s National Medical Products Administration (“NMPA”) has agreed to accept New Drug Application with priority review for Tinlarebant for the treatment of Stargardt disease based on the interim analysis results

 

· United Kingdom’s Medicines and Healthcare Products Regulatory Agency (MHRA) has agreed to accept Conditional Marketing Authorization application for Tinlarebant for the treatment of Stargardt disease based on the interim analysis results

 

· Trial completed, final topline data remains on track for Q4 2025.

 


 

 

 

o DRAGON II Trial: Combination of a Phase 1b open-label trial to evaluate the pharmacokinetics and pharmacodynamics of Tinlarebant in adolescent Japanese STGD1 patients and a Phase 2/3, 24-month, randomized (1:1, active: placebo), double-masked, placebo-controlled, multicenter trial in adolescent STGD1 patients

  

· The Company has enrolled 34 subjects in the Phase 2/3 trial, with a target enrollment of approximately 60 subjects, aged 12 to 20 years old, including approximately 10 Japanese subjects. Data from the Japanese subjects are intended to facilitate a future new drug application in Japan.

 

· Primary efficacy endpoint is the growth rate of atrophic lesions; safety and tolerability will also be assessed.

 

· Geographic Atrophy (GA): GA is a chronic degenerative disease of the retina that leads to blindness in the elderly. Accumulation of bisretinoids has been implicated in the progression of GA. There are currently no FDA-approved, orally administered treatments for GA.

 

o PHOENIX Trial: Ongoing, 24-month, randomized (2:1, active: placebo), double-masked, placebo-controlled, global, multi-center, pivotal Phase 3 trial in GA patients

 

· Enrollment completed with 530 subjects.

 

· Primary efficacy endpoint is the growth rate of atrophic lesions; safety and tolerability will also be assessed.

 

· The Company expects to conduct an interim analysis.

Third Quarter 2025 Financial Results:

 

Current Assets:

 

As of September 30, 2025, the Company had $275.6 million in cash, liquidity funds, and U.S treasury bills.

 

R&D Expenses:

 

For the three months ended September 30, 2025, research and development expenses were $10.3 million compared to $6.8 million for the same period in 2024. The increase in research and development expenses in the quarter was primarily attributable to (i) expenses related to the DRAGON trial and PHOENIX trial, partially offsetting the Australian research and development tax incentive, which is recognized as a reduction to research and development expenses; (ii) share-based compensation expenses. For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, research and development expenses were $30.8 million compared to $22.7 million for the same period in 2024. The increase in research and development expenses was primarily attributable to (i) expenses related to the PHOENIX trial; (ii) share-based compensation expenses; and (iii) manufacturing expenses, partially offset by the non-recurrence of a royalty payment recognized in 2024 for completion of a Phase 2 trial.

 

G&A Expenses:

 

For the three months ended September 30, 2025, general and administrative expenses were $12.7 million compared to $2.9 million for the same period in 2024. For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, general and administration expenses were $25.4 million compared to $5.9 million for the same period in 2024. The increase in general and administrative expenses in both the quarter and year-to-date was primarily due to an increase in share-based compensation expenses.

 

Other Income:

 

For the three months ended September 30, 2025, other income was $1.3 million compared to $1.1 million for the same period in 2024. For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, other income was $3.8 million compared to $2.5 million for the same period in 2024. The increase in both the quarter and year-to-date was attributed to interest from time deposits and U.S. treasury bills.

 

Net Loss:

 

For the three months ended September 30, 2025, the Company reported a net loss of $21.7 million, compared to a net loss of $8.7 million for the same period in 2024. For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, the Company reported a net loss of $52.3 million, compared to a net loss of $26.0 million for the same period in 2024.

About Belite Bio

 

Belite Bio is a clinical-stage drug development company focused on advancing novel therapeutics targeting degenerative retinal diseases that have significant unmet medical need, such as STGD1 and GA in advanced dry AMD, in addition to specific metabolic diseases. Belite’s lead candidate, Tinlarebant, an oral therapy intended to reduce the accumulation of bisretinoid toxins in the eye, is currently being evaluated in a Phase 3 study (DRAGON) and a Phase 2/3 study (DRAGON II) in adolescent STGD1 subjects and a Phase 3 study (PHOENIX) in subjects with GA.
